A Closer Look at Seopjikoji

Seopjikoji is much more than just a scenic viewpoint. Its dramatic cliffs, windswept hills, and expansive ocean views make it a photographer’s dream. The landscape is perfect for capturing wide-angle shots of the coastline, especially with the lighthouse and Seongsan Ilchulbong in the background.
Historically, this location gained fame from being a filming site for the popular K-drama All In, which still draws fans eager to see the real-life backdrop. Nowadays, it’s a trendy spot for young visitors who want to snap selfies with the sweeping scenery.
You’ll love the way the wind adds movement to your photos, and many travelers find the view of Seongsan Ilchulbong from the lighthouse particularly captivating. It’s worth noting that the area can be quite windy and exposed, so dressing in layers is advisable.

Practical Tips for Visiting Seopjikoji

- Timing: Early morning or late afternoon offers softer light for photos and fewer crowds.
- Clothing: Wear layers and sturdy shoes — the wind can be brisk, and the terrain can be uneven.
- Photo opportunities: The lighthouse, Seongsan Ilchulbong, and coastal cliffs are must-captures.
